Harmony, MN vs Milaca, MN
Harmony is moderately more affordable than Milaca, with a 14.4% lower cost of living index. Harmony scores 66 compared to 78 for Milaca, where the US average is 100. This difference means residents of Milaca can expect to pay noticeably more for everyday expenses, housing, and services.
On the housing front, median rent in Harmony is $698/month compared to $854/month in Milaca — a 18% difference. Home values follow the same pattern: Harmony is more affordable at $154,800 median vs $184,900.
Median household income in Harmony is $65,536 compared to $49,063 in Milaca (+33.6%). Harmony offers a double advantage: higher earnings combined with a lower cost of living, giving residents significantly more purchasing power. Looking at affordability, residents of Harmony spend roughly 12.8% of their income on rent, less than the 20.9% in Milaca.
Climate-wise, both cities share similar average temperatures (44.8°F vs 42.9°F). Harmony receives more rainfall at 34.7" per year compared to 28.5" in Milaca.
